Gibraltar Industries Inc
At its core, Gibraltar Industries Inc. operates within the ever-evolving landscape of building products, drawing its strength from a diverse portfolio that ambitiously spans various segments, including renewable energy, residential, and infrastructure markets. The company’s journey is a tale of strategic evolution, where it has expertly maneuvered through different industry shifts to cement itself as a key player, particularly in the building products sector. Beginning as a modest operation, Gibraltar has methodically expanded its reach and capabilities by acquiring firms that complement its growth strategy. This calculated expansion has allowed Gibraltar to fortify its market position, particularly in offering metal roofing and ventilation products, shaking hands with the essence of sustainable living and energy-efficient solutions.
Gibraltar's revenue engine is fueled by its innovative approach to addressing both modern and traditional construction needs. The company derives its financial vitality not merely from the sale of goods, but through its strong emphasis on practical and sustainable business solutions. It capitalizes on the growing demand for renewable energy infrastructure, especially solar racking systems, tapping into the global shift towards cleaner energy sources. This adaptability enables Gibraltar to serve a wide array of customers ranging from homeowners needing residential ventilation systems, to large-scale projects requiring custom-engineered building components. The company’s capacity to balance both direct sales and project-based offerings showcases its versatility, solidifying Gibraltar Industries as a robust entity capable of driving growth even amidst market volatilities.

Sales Growth: Adjusted net sales grew 13% overall, with significant contribution from recent acquisitions, though some areas like Agtech and Mail and Package faced lower demand.
Margins: Adjusted EPS and operating income were slightly below last year, down less than 1%, while adjusted EBITDA was flat. Margin pressure came from business mix and integration costs.
Cash Flow: Strong cash performance with $57 million generated from operations, up 39%, and free cash flow at $49 million or 16% of sales.
Guidance Update: 2025 net sales expected between $1.15–$1.175 billion (up ~15%), with adjusted EPS guidance raised to $4.20–$4.30 (up 10%–12%).
Agtech Momentum: Agtech bookings and backlog accelerated sharply, with bookings up 121% and backlog up 110%. New customer wins are expected to drive more consistent and higher-margin growth.
Residential Market: Residential segment outperformed a weak roofing market, though organic revenue was down 1%. Integration of recent acquisitions is underway.
Balance Sheet: The company remains debt free with $89 million cash on hand and $394 million of revolver capacity; $200 million remains under share repurchase authorization.
Portfolio Actions: Sale of the renewables business is progressing, targeted for completion by year-end, and M&A pipeline remains active, especially in residential products.
